Greg Palumbo, Exhibits Manager at Ah-Tah-Thi-Ki, my work email is [log in to unmask] We worked with Quatrefoil to develop a timeline of the Seminole Wars for our Surface, we are also running a couple of free programs that come with the table, and we are in development with Quatrefoil on a second program. Our plan is to add a program a year for four to five years. I would be happy to talk with anyone about the table and our experience with it. We are very happy with the Surface so far.
